BUS 208 Chapter 9 Homework i Saved 5 Suds & Cuts is a local pet grooming shop owned by Collin Bark. Collin has prepared the following standard cost card for each dog bath given: 3 points Standard Quantity Standard Rate Shampoo 2.8 oz. $ 0.40 per oz. Water 26 gal. $ 0.04 per gal. Direct labor 1.6 hr. $12.00 per hr. Standard Unit Cost $ 1.12 1.04 19.20 eBook During the month of July, Collin's employees gave 460 baths. The actual results were 780 ounces of shampoo used (cost of $405.60). 7,600 gallons of water used (cost of $608), and labor costs for 400 hours (cost of $5,400). Hint Required: 1. Calculate Suds & Cuts direct materials variances for both shampoo and water for the month of July. 2. Calculate Suds & Cuts direct labor variances for the month of July. References Complete this question by entering your answers in the tabs below. Required 1 Required 2 Calculate Suds & Cuts direct materials variances for both shampoo and water for the month of July. (Round your answers to 2 decimal places. Indicate the effect of each variance by selecting "F" for favorable, "U" for unfavorable, and "None" for no effect (I.e., zero variance).)
